Kolkata: Extended tax holiday for CNG, electric vehicles
KOLKATA: The state transport department has announced an extension of tax holiday for two-wheeler and four-wheeler electric vehicles (EVs) and all categories of CNG vehicles until March 31, 2025. The announcement, made by transport secretary Saumitra Mohan, includes a one-time exemption from registration fees, tax, and additional tax.
The notification emphasized that this tax exemption aims to significantly encourage the use of clean-fuel vehicles.
The extended exemption is effective from April 1, 2024. The announcement was delayed due to the election model code of conduct.
The earlier exemption period, from April 1, 2022, to March 31, 2024, offered complete exemption from registration fees and financial incentives to boost the use of cleaner fuel in automobiles, which contribute to over 30% of the city's ambient air pollution. The new notification states that vehicles registered from April 1, 2022, until the issuance of this notification, can get an extension of tax validity for the days covered within the exemption period. However, adjustment or refund of registration fees already paid is not allowed.
CNG is cleaner compared to petrol and diesel, reducing carbon monoxide emissions by approximately 80% and hydrocarbons by 44%. Electric vehicles, on the other hand, emit no pollutant and generate no noise.
